解决VPN连接失败(错误代码800)的全面指南—网络工程师亲测有效方法

banxian11 2026-05-12 半仙加速器 1 0

作为一名资深网络工程师,我经常遇到用户报告“VPN连接失败,错误代码800”的问题,这个错误在Windows系统中尤为常见,通常出现在使用PPTP、L2TP/IPSec或OpenVPN等协议连接远程服务器时,它可能由多种原因引起,包括配置错误、防火墙干扰、证书问题或服务未启动,本文将从排查逻辑到实操步骤,为你提供一套完整、高效的解决方案。

明确错误代码800的含义,微软官方文档指出,该错误表示“无法建立与远程计算机的连接”,常见于拨号网络或虚拟专用网络(VPN)客户端尝试连接时,它不是硬件故障,而是软件层面的问题,因此无需更换设备,只需调整配置即可。

第一步:检查本地网络环境
确保你的电脑能正常访问互联网,打开浏览器访问任意网站(如www.baidu.com),确认无DNS解析失败,若无法联网,请先解决基础网络问题,然后检查是否被ISP(互联网服务提供商)屏蔽了特定端口(如PPTP的TCP 1723和GRE协议),部分运营商对PPTP协议限制严格,建议改用更稳定的L2TP/IPSec或OpenVPN。

第二步:验证VPN配置参数
进入“网络和共享中心” → “更改适配器设置” → 双击你的VPN连接 → 属性 → “安全”选项卡,确认以下几点:

  • 协议选择正确:若服务器支持,优先使用L2TP/IPSec或OpenVPN;避免使用已过时的PPTP。
  • 身份验证方式:选择“Microsoft CHAP Version 2 (MS-CHAP v2)”,并确保密码正确无误。
  • 加密强度:勾选“加密数据包”以增强安全性。

第三步:重启相关服务
按下Win+R键,输入services.msc,找到以下服务并逐一重启:

  • Remote Access Connection Manager(远程访问连接管理器)
  • Remote Access Auto Connection Manager(自动连接管理器)
  • IPsec Policy Agent(IPSec策略代理)
    这些服务负责处理VPN握手和加密协商,若卡顿或未运行会导致连接中断。

第四步:防火墙与杀毒软件干扰排查
Windows Defender防火墙或第三方杀毒软件(如360、卡巴斯基)可能拦截VPN流量,临时关闭防火墙测试连接是否成功,若成功,则需在防火墙规则中添加例外:允许“网络连接”类应用(如Cisco AnyConnect、OpenVPN GUI)通过,具体操作路径:控制面板 → Windows Defender 防火墙 → 允许应用或功能通过防火墙。

第五步:更新或重装VPN客户端
如果以上均无效,可能是客户端本身损坏,卸载当前VPN软件后,从官网下载最新版本重新安装,对于企业用户,建议联系IT部门获取最新配置文件(.ovpn或.pcf格式)。

若仍无法解决,请收集日志信息:在命令提示符中执行netsh ras show connections查看连接状态,并使用事件查看器(eventvwr.msc)筛选“System”和“Application”日志中的错误事件,定位具体故障点。

错误代码800虽常见,但按上述流程逐步排查,95%的问题都能解决,网络问题往往是多因素叠加的结果,耐心调试是关键,作为网络工程师,我常提醒用户:“不要急着重启电脑,先看日志!” —— 这才是专业之道。

解决VPN连接失败(错误代码800)的全面指南—网络工程师亲测有效方法

半仙加速器-海外加速器|VPN加速器|vpn翻墙加速器|VPN梯子|VPN外网加速